2024 PINOT GRIS
Compared to previous years, the 2024 vintage was marked by regular rainfall. The vines were evenly supplied throughout the growing season, allowing for steady development and healthy grape structures. As a result, the Pinot Gris was able to ripen calmly and was deliberately harvested late – a year that rewarded time, precision and close attention, giving the wine its clear structure and poise.
FOODPAIRING
Ideal with finely balanced dishes of natural aromatics: pan-fried fennel with orange zest, pasta with saffron butter and young spinach, or poached Arctic char with cucumber and dill salad. Also an excellent match for goat’s cheese tart, couscous with roasted vegetables and lemon oil.
Pinot Gris
On the nose, fine yellow fruit, pear and a hint of citrus zest. On the palate, balanced and composed, with gentle creaminess, moderate acidity and clear structure. Harmonious and precise, finishing fresh and elegant.
